gpt4 book ai didi

php - 如何向 PHP 下拉查询添加空白选择?

转载 作者:行者123 更新时间:2023-11-29 10:20:57 26 4
gpt4 key购买 nike

在创建的下拉列表中,它会自动从列表中选择第一个员工姓名。当选择不同的员工时,页面会刷新并再次选择列表中的第一个员工。有没有办法让默认选择为空白?

$sql = "SELECT name FROM employee";
$result = $conn->query($sql);

while ($row = $result->fetch_assoc()) { unset($name); $name = $row['name'];
echo '<option value="'.$name.'">'.$name.'</option>'; }

最佳答案

添加默认值,例如:

while ($row = $result->fetch_assoc()) { unset($name); $name = $row['name']; 

echo '<option value="'.$name.'"'.($isDefaultValue ? "selected":"").'>'.$name.'</option>'; }

您需要创建 $isDefaultValue 变量来确定给定记录是否为默认记录,或者如果您想创建第一个空白条目,请使用:

echo '<option value="-1" selected>This is only default value, pick real one!</option>';

然后检查您的 Controller ,如果用户选择“默认”-1 值或真实值

关于php - 如何向 PHP 下拉查询添加空白选择?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49266797/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com